8:45-9:00: Quiet Time: (entering the Word of the Day into his/her Quick Word book, entering Today’s Number on 200 chart and doing tally marks, and organizing for day)

 

9:00-9:15: Morning Meeting (class leader is in charge): Attendance, lunch count, calendar, Pledge of Allegiance, Word of the day, Morning Message, 10 Minute Math (see Investigations), Daily News Reporter selected

 

9:15-10:15:  Reading Workshop:  This workshop begins with the teacher reading a book related to our current theme.  Discussion follows as to what the expectations and focus will be during the workshop.  Then, students self-select literature to read alone or quietly with a friend.  I monitor progress by frequently checking in with student conferences.  Students may also be in a reading group with peers who are approximately on the same level.  Each student is responsible for keeping an accurate reading record found in his/her reading folder.  This workshop ends with a student sharing a book (Book Talk) that he/she enjoyed during the workshop.

 

10:15-10:45- Snack/DEAR Time: Students quietly get snacks and are responsible for carefully cleaning up after themselves.  They may read quietly until the remainder of the class finishes eating.

 

10:45-12:00- Writing Workshop: Students are involved in journal writing or working on long term writing projects.  We use the Six Traits writing program as a model.    The last 10 minutes of this workshop is reserved for the Author’s Chair where students voluntarily share their writing.  This is also the time when we work on handwriting.  We use the Zaner-Blozer program.  Spelling is also a focus at this time.  We use the Fountas and Pinnell program.
